## Handover: Thumbgrove queue

Handing the thumbnail generation queue to Priya for review. Key points: workers pull from the resize queue, dedupe on content hash, and write variants to the cold store. The retry backoff was recently doubled after the August stampede; please scrutinize that change. The worker configuration currently deployed is as follows.

config for fawig-fajep:
[ulaael]
team = istion
access_code = ac_12ee45
host = ulaael.olvarqnet.local
port = 7000
owner = eliiel.ulaath
peer = holdor.torvagrid.example

**Ticket BF-2214 — Signature check failing on Fernwick cache tier**

Heads up: the bloom filter we put in front of the Quillstone KV store started rejecting the signed manifest on Tuesday's deploy. Looks like the verifier is still pinned to the old rotation from Q2, so every membership snapshot fails validation and we fall through to raw KV reads — bad for latency, worse for tamper detection. Can a security reviewer confirm the trust chain? The verifier should be pinned to the key below.

signing key of bagap-yawep = bky13_TbfT6ZMUoGJo2

Finance Review Summary — Board

The new Lanternwell Plus subscription tier completed its first full quarter. Uptake reached 14,200 subscribers against a forecast of 12,500, with churn at 2.1% monthly, below the standard tier. Incremental revenue contribution was 1.8m, though support costs ran 12% over budget due to onboarding volume. Margins should normalise as tooling matures. Payback on acquisition spend is tracking at seven months. The tier's role in our wider plans is outlined in the confidential note below.

management briefing: The pricing group signed off on a budget of $378.8 million for Project Kasael.